There is the highest probability that the recycled
paper that .A.S.A. supplies to the company CIUR
will take part in next year’s Olympic Games in So-
chi. While many athletes around the world are still
fighting for the chance to compete, the presence
of tour paper at the games has been more or less
assured.
You might ask how this is possible. Simple. Sin-
ce 2000, .A.S.A. has been a partner of the Czech
company CIUR ( www.ciur.cz) which is one of the
leaders in Europe and around the world in pro-
ducing high-quality cellulose fibres from recycled
paper. All of its cellulose products are made only
from selected recycled material in the Czech Re-
public.
Its product development is focused primarily on
the high level of usage of such recycled material,
thus demonstrating the maximum concern for
the environment. In addition to industrial fibres,
energy-efficient insulation systems and HVAC pro-
ducts play a major role in the company’s portfolio.
